    Pacific Rim is a science fiction media franchise that consists of Kaiju-monster installments. It includes two theatrical films , Pacific Rim (2013) and Pacific Rim Uprising (2018), and an animated television series , Pacific Rim: The Black (2021–2022).

    Three-Sixty Pacific was an American video game publisher and developer. Founded in the late 1980s by avid wargamers and military history enthusiasts, they were acquired by IntraCorp Entertainment Inc. in 1994.

    Strategic Command is a series of computer video games developed by Fury Software and Battlefront.com, and published by Excalibur Publishing.     According to M. Evan Brooks of Computer Gaming World, Carrier Strike had reached sales of 15,000 copies by September 1992. [7] The game was released in competition with Carriers at War by Strategic Studies Group, [4] a game whose highly-anticipated status drew more attention toward Carrier Strike, Computer Gaming World ' s Alan Emrich argued.
